We bought this book to accompany the purchase of an SPT SS-301 Multi-Cooker Shabu Shabu and Grill. We always wanted to do shabu shabu at home, but have no knowledge on where to begin. Sure, we can find recipes and instructions online, but why bother with the trouble when you have all the basic information you need in a neat collection ready for you to reference when you need it? The book provide recipes for base broth (e.g. dashi, etc.), dipping sauce/condiment, meat based hot pot, seafood based hot pot, veggie hot pot and everything goes hot pot. It also goes into details on common ingredients, such as negi (welsh onion), what they are and flavor profile. Once you've found your favorite recipe and base broth, the combination is literally up to your imagination.

This book is as much about what Japanese Hot Pot is, as it is recipes on how to make it. The first 35 pages of the cookbook cover Hot Pot culture, ingredients, basic techniques and basic recipes. The remainder of the book divides recipes into categories based on whether vegetarian or by the type of meat is used as the main ingredient. I would have liked to see more information on substitutions. While the book does describe some substitutions, for others the authors just assume the reader has access to a Japanese or Asian market. That's simply not true for all of us.

The great thing about hot pots is that most of them are super easy one pot meals. And they're quite comforting during the winter months (or all year if you live in San Francisco!).If you have access to an Asian supermarket, you can probably find most of what you need. Most of the ingredients for the soup bases are non-perishable or have a very long shelf life, so definitely consider stocking up on those. If you can't find something or live out in the sticks, many of the non-perishables are available online. Some of the fresh ingredients can often be substituted or omitted. Don't like tofu? No problem, skip it. Don't have napa cabbage? Then toss in some regular cabbage or broccoli instead. Etc.If you can't get the ingredients or don't want to commit to purchasing them, then you can use this book as a general guide. And definitely let google be your friend for helping with substitutions. For example, you can substitute dry sherry for sake (rice wine), and add some sugar to make a mirin substitute. If you don't want to make dashi stock from scratch, then get the instant powdered kind. Or maybe even consider using watered down fat free chicken broth in its place. I've owned this book for around a year and occasionally flip through it. Despite having easy access to just about every ingredient in the book, I don't think I've ever followed any of these recipes to the letter.The book is loaded with nice photos and is well written. It's an excellent source of inspiration for those cold winter (and summer) evenings.If you want to cook at the table, then I'd suggest getting a butane stove and some butane fuel canisters. They're very cheap, and unlike portable electric stoves, you can take them anywhere (like a picnic!).
